Safety precautions
Placement
Set  the  unit  up  on  an  even  surface  away  from  direct 
sunlight, high temperatures, high humidity, and excessive 
vibration. These conditions can damage the cabinet and 
other components, thereby shortening the unit’s service life.
Place  it  at  least  15  cm  away  from  wall  surfaces  to  avoid 
distortion and unwanted acoustical effects.
Do not place heavy items on the unit.
Voltage
Do not use high voltage power sources. This can overload 
the unit and cause a fi re.
Do not use a DC power source. Check the source carefully 
when setting the unit up on a ship or other place where DC 
is used.
AC mains lead protection
Ensure the AC mains lead is connected correctly and not 
damaged. Poor connection and lead damage can cause fi re 
or electric shock. Do not pull, bend, or place heavy items on 
the lead.
Grasp the plug fi rmly when unplugging the lead. Pulling the 
AC mains lead can cause electric shock.
Do not handle the plug with wet hands. This can cause 
electric shock.
Foreign matter
Do not let metal objects fall inside the unit. This can cause 
electric shock or malfunction.
Do not let liquids get into the unit. This can cause electric 
shock or malfunction. If this occurs, immediately disconnect 
the unit from the power supply and contact your dealer.
Do not spray insecticides onto or into the unit. They contain 
fl ammable gases which can ignite if sprayed into the unit.
Service
Do not attempt to repair this unit by yourself. If sound is 
interrupted,  indicators  fail  to  light,  smoke  appears,  or  any 
other problem that is not covered in these instructions occurs, 
disconnect the AC mains lead and contact your dealer or 
an authorized service center. Electric shock or damage to 
the unit can occur if the unit is repaired, disassembled or 
reconstructed by unqualifi ed persons.
Extend operating life by disconnecting the unit from the 
power source if it is not to be used for a long time.
